While Coventry Arena Train Station may not boast a ticket office, ticket machines are readily available to help you collect tickets purchased online. For our friends with accessibility needs, you'll be pleased to know that these machines are designed to be user-friendly. You’ll also find an induction loop for those with hearing impairments.
In terms of accessibility, the station is classified as step-free access category B1, which means there is step-free access to all platforms, although this may involve navigating ramps or accessing platforms via the street. Assistance is readily available, and more information can be found on the Official Rail Regulator website.
Finally, while there are no toilets or waiting rooms, the station does have bicycle storage available, providing 10 spaces across two shelters with CCTV coverage.
Coventry Arena is well-connected, with efficient links to other modes of transport, including local bus services. In case of rail disruptions, replacement services operate from the road between the station and the retail park. Additional information and walking directions to the rail replacement bus stop can be found via Google Maps.

When it comes to facilities, Exeter St David's has got you covered. The ticket office operates extensive hours, from 5:45 AM to 8:40 PM on weekdays, ensuring seamless access to your travel needs. For those who prefer digital solutions, ticket machines are available, supporting online purchases and providing excellent accessibility at the station entrance. Step-free access to all platforms through lifts underscores its commitment to making travel easy for everyone.
CCTV cameras assure security, and for those last-minute needs, WHSmith and cafes are on-site to cater to your essentials. Public Wi-Fi is freely available to keep you connected, and if you're in a hurry, a selection of vending machines will keep you energized. Cycling enthusiasts will be pleased to find ample bicycle storage as well as a Brompton Dock hire service for convenient onward travel.
Exeter St David's provides an array of transport links that make it incredibly convenient to continue your journey. Whether you need a local taxi available right at the station's entrance or a bus, you'll find what you need to reach your final destination effortlessly. With regular buses connecting directly to Exeter Airport, consider purchasing an Exeter PLUSBUS ticket to simplify your transit.
